Lonegan: It’s an absurd political stunt

Says Gottheimer wants to bring back Obama-Pelosi policies

By David Wildstein, March 02 2018 8:42 am

Former Bogota Mayor Steve Lonegan says a charitable dedication proposal advocated by Rep. Josh Gottheimer (D-Wyckoff) is just an absurd political stunt by a liberal.  He says the “taxpayers deserve better than a two-faced politician who is a cheerleader for an agenda that will break their backs.”

“While the American people are now enjoying the fruits of the Republican agenda, Josh Gottheimer wants to bring back the disastrous Obama-Pelosi policies which failed to create jobs and delivered anemic economic growth,” said Lonegan, who is seeking the Republican nomination in New Jersey’s 5th district.  “Who is Josh Gottheimer trying to kid?

Lonegan says that thanks to Republicans and their tax relief plan, more jobs, a stronger stock market and economic growth “is right around the corner.”

“Josh Gottheimer fought tooth and nail against these tax cuts for working Americans. Now, all he can do is concoct absurd ideas that amount to nothing but a publicity stunt,” said Lonegan. “While he claims to be working for taxpayers, he’s using this issue to soften up his own constituents for the coming Phil Murphy tax-and-spend body blow.”
